Old World monkeys
Refers to monkeys that live in the Old World continents of Africa and Asia. They are classified in the primate order Cercopithecidae, a family of monkeys that is further divided into two subfamilies: Cercopithecinae and Colobinae. The former includes macaques, mangabeys, baboons, and guenons, while the latter includes colobus monkeys and langurs. Old World monkeys, along with New World monkeys and the superfamily Hominoidea, are one of the pillars that make up the anthropoid order.
